Aug 19, 2008 at 1:50 pm #1447705I'll write it out when I get back from my trip. Basically it is 4 cups of all purpose flour, 1 cup of white sugar and 1 pound of real butter. This makes 8 rounds or 64 pieces. It's more about the handling and technique. You have to knead the flour in but then treat it like pastry. It is also cooked for an hour or more in a very low oven.
